San Gabriel Valley Airport (ICAO: KEMT) is a public airport in El Monte, in Los Angeles County, California, USA. In November 2014, its name was changed from El Monte Airport to San Gabriel Valley Airport.

The airport was constructed and operated by the U.S. Army in 1942 as Hayward Army Airfield. It was used as a base for fighter aircraft during WWII, including the legendary P-51 Mustang and P-38 Lightning. The California Air National Guard moved onto land adjoining the airport in 1949. Initially it was the home of the 61st Fighter Wing which included the 194th Fighter Squadron on June 25, 1948.

Today, San Gabriel Valley Airport is a thriving general aviation facility, facilitating over 116,000 aircraft takeoffs and landings in 2025. The airport is home to over 300 based aircraft, a popular on-site restaurant, and a variety of aviation businesses and nonprofit organizations. Additionally, the airport serves as an emergency-preparedness center, with aerial firefighting and law-enforcement support, disaster relief, search-and-rescue, and air-ambulance services. With a continuously operating Airport Traffic Control Tower, modern navigational aids, and an Automated Weather Observing System (AWOS), the airport safely and efficiently accommodates helicopters and a wide range of aircraft from small, single-engine trainers to larger turboprop and business jet aircraft.
